Population Overview
Augusta CDP is a small community located in Montana. The total population is 222. It ranks as the 234th most populous out of 470 cities and towns in Montana.
Age Demographics
The median age in Augusta CDP is 63.2 years. This is 57% higher than the state median of 40.2 years. Only 9.9% of residents are under 18, indicating fewer families with children. 19.8% of residents are 75 or older, suggesting a significant retirement-age population with implications for healthcare services and senior housing.
Economy, Income & Housing
The median household income in Augusta CDP is $43,333. This is 38% lower than the state median of $69,922. Compared to the national median of $78,538, household income here is 45% lower. The poverty rate stands at 16.7%. This is 38% higher than the state poverty rate of 12.0%. The unemployment rate is 0.0%. This is 100% lower than the state rate of 3.8%. The median home value is $215,000. Housing costs are 36% lower than the state median of $338,100. The home-value-to-income ratio is 5.0x. 57.9%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 17% lower than the state average of 69.4%.
Race & Ethnicity
Augusta CDP has a predominantly White (non-Hispanic) population, comprising 91.9% of all residents.
Education
23.0%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 33% lower than the state rate of 34.5%. Nationally, 35.0%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 96.5%.
Data Sources & Methodology
All demographic data for Augusta CDP, Montana is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ates (2019-2023). The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ually, providing reliable estimates for communities of all sizes. Comparisons are made against Montana state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 470 Census-designated places in Montana.
